steve
c2f90ac911
Careful about compiletf calls.
2003-03-01 00:46:13 +00:00
steve
21b0f4955e
Allow read of realvar as int.
2003-02-28 21:20:34 +00:00
steve
feee40603c
Makefile cleanups to better support concurrent make.
2003-02-27 22:13:22 +00:00
steve
3a653c73e7
Add scope type have a vpi_get function.
2003-02-27 21:54:44 +00:00
steve
aa3297a925
Add the cvt/vr instruction.
2003-02-27 20:36:29 +00:00
steve
5ca6991067
Some error messages around asserts.
2003-02-25 01:17:28 +00:00
steve
70daee399f
Interactive task calls take string arguments.
2003-02-24 06:35:45 +00:00
steve
7f8433148c
Add to interactive stop mode support for
...
current scope, the ability to scan/traverse
scopes, and the ability to call system tasks.
2003-02-23 06:41:54 +00:00
steve
5b7c1bc7e2
Basic support for system task calls.
2003-02-22 06:32:36 +00:00
steve
2935e28ffb
When checking for stop, remember to reschedule.
2003-02-22 06:26:58 +00:00
steve
1951a81a0b
Use ranlib where available, for MacOSX
2003-02-22 04:39:32 +00:00
steve
19c6bd2139
Check for stopped flag in certain strategic points.
2003-02-22 02:52:06 +00:00
steve
2de0597038
Add vpiStop and interactive mode.
2003-02-21 03:40:35 +00:00
steve
de4bfe4e4f
Document new -lxt and -vcd extended arguments.
2003-02-20 00:50:28 +00:00
steve
ec48049a69
Strict correctness of vpi_free_object results.
2003-02-17 00:58:38 +00:00
steve
74192632fa
Permanent allocate vpiSignals more efficiently.
2003-02-16 23:40:05 +00:00
steve
fe4546498b
Take the global_flag to ivl_dlopen.
2003-02-16 05:42:06 +00:00
steve
66785b7997
Support .vpl files as loadable LIBRARIES.
2003-02-16 02:21:20 +00:00
steve
2713694338
Include vpiRealVar objects in vpiVariables scan.
2003-02-11 05:20:45 +00:00
steve
dcbb8d0780
Add value change callbacks to real variables.
2003-02-10 05:20:10 +00:00
steve
b726395d1e
Spelling fixes.
2003-02-09 23:33:26 +00:00
steve
3c18663c3f
Mke getopt ignore options after the file name.
2003-02-07 02:45:05 +00:00
steve
dd56d9a17c
Add the %sub/wr instruction.
2003-02-06 17:41:47 +00:00
steve
68de9bf5d2
Support constant types for thread words.
2003-02-06 17:41:33 +00:00
steve
be4be5c650
Add hex and binary formatting of real values.
2003-02-04 04:03:40 +00:00
steve
ce489d8d84
Allow $display of $simtime.
2003-02-03 01:09:20 +00:00
steve
27f7a00df0
Proper rounding of scaled integer time.
2003-02-02 02:14:14 +00:00
steve
222f15c293
Five vpi_free_object a default behavior.
2003-02-02 01:40:24 +00:00
steve
fec6a10771
Make $time and $realtime available to $display uniquely.
2003-02-01 05:50:04 +00:00
steve
04ada23119
Support in various contexts the $realtime
...
system task.
2003-01-27 00:14:37 +00:00
steve
7de4108bad
Add %cvt/ir and %cvt/ri instructions, and support
...
real values passed as arguments to VPI tasks.
2003-01-26 18:16:22 +00:00
steve
9a5a00f836
Add thread word array, and add the instructions,
...
%add/wr, %cmp/wr, %load/wr, %mul/wr and %set/wr.
2003-01-25 23:48:05 +00:00
steve
dfc9a9474a
Add a dummy function to reduce confusion on some systems.
2003-01-19 00:03:23 +00:00
steve
ddd43f1378
Add a means to clear the module search path.
2003-01-18 23:55:35 +00:00
steve
4ec91047dd
Ignore vvp.exp
2003-01-10 19:02:47 +00:00
steve
0579ae08cd
Add missing vpi entry points.
2003-01-10 19:02:21 +00:00
steve
9074999666
Remove thunks from vpi init.
2003-01-10 19:01:38 +00:00
steve
301cbe31ad
Remove vpithunk, and move libvpi to vvp directory.
2003-01-10 03:06:32 +00:00
steve
6416f8b90e
Add vpi_put_userdata
2003-01-09 04:09:44 +00:00
steve
e6eae5fd15
Allocate res-buf in bigger chunks
2003-01-07 18:07:50 +00:00
steve
aa3a6dba4e
Schedule wait lists of threads as a single event,
...
to save on events. Also, improve efficiency of
event_s allocation. Add some event statistics to
get an idea where performance is really going.
2003-01-06 23:57:26 +00:00
steve
c2070777b2
The $time system task returns the integer time
...
scaled to the local units. Change the internal
implementation of vpiSystemTime the $time functions
to properly account for this. Also add $simtime
to get the simulation time.
2002-12-21 00:55:57 +00:00
steve
8ab909a765
Add vpi_handle_by_name to the VPI interface,
...
and bump the vpithunk magic number.
2002-12-11 23:55:22 +00:00
steve
ef55086543
Support put of vpiStringVal to signals.
2002-11-25 23:33:45 +00:00
steve
8e30bc9f9e
Careful of left operands to shift that are constant.
2002-11-22 00:01:50 +00:00
steve
03afbf157b
%set/x0 instruction to support bounds checking.
2002-11-21 22:43:13 +00:00
steve
4539632f34
Add vpiScope iterate on vpiScope objects.
2002-11-15 22:14:12 +00:00
steve
013b18b3dc
leading underscore test for Windows more robust.
2002-11-09 06:03:57 +00:00
steve
1b84893ccb
Add the %assign/v0 instruction.
2002-11-08 04:59:57 +00:00
steve
b0a7909162
functor_set takes bit and strength, not 2 strengths.
2002-11-07 03:11:43 +00:00